Photograph of You

 Supplies Used

3 Tubes by Garvey (HERE)
“Vampire’s Kiss” (NAME)
“Everything about You” by Kristin Aagard (HERE)
Mask 208 by WeeScottLass (HERE)
Spotlight (HERE)
Eye Candy 5: Bevel

Let's Begin!

Create a canvas 900 x 900. Use paper 4, and apply mask; resize to 800 widths when complete and add to the canvas; center.

Warp the mask by pulling at the sides and squishing it into an oblong shape. Duplicate mask and merge together to darken.

Open the film frame, crop out one single frame and then re-size by 35%; add mask layer. Duplicate and mirror, then merge the layers together.

Open tape 2, resize by 15% and add in two places on the film frame.

Open the camera and resize by 27% and add to the canvas; center manually.

Open the two labels used, and crop out each individual word. Resize “my” by 40%; “favourite”, “snapshot”, “you”, “me”, and “us” by 35% then arrange how you see it in the design.

Find three tubes of your choice by your favourite designer. Resize as needed, trying to fill the whole frame opening. Duplicate each image to add to the opposite side.

Duplicate the tube images, add penta jeans to each of the duplicates and drop the opacity to 200; do not merge together.

Drop shadow everything to your liking. Add your own personal touches now.

Crop/resize to your liking then add your name with copyright.
